System-Subsystem Dependency Network for Integrating Multicomponent Data and Its Application to Health Sciences

Abstract: With the ever-increasing demand of collecting and analyzing a large volume of data collected from different sources, computational models and methodsones that allow for the integration of data sets to help understand a phenomenon from a broad, comprehensive systems perspective-are called for. Two features are commonly observed in large and complex systems. First, a system is made up of multiple subsystems. Second, there exists fragmented data.
